What Google Cloud Platform (GCP) for e-commerce means:

Scalability and flexibility

Dynamic resource adjustment to meet e-commerce demands

Google Cloud Platform (GCP) offers dynamic resource scaling, which is essential for online shops. With automatic scaling, GCP allows computing power and memory to be adjusted effortlessly to meet current business requirements. During periods of heightened traffic, such as sales events, the platform can absorb increased demand without any downtime. GCP’s flexibility also supports the rapid deployment of new features and the management of containerised applications, ensuring uninterrupted performance and customer satisfaction.

Containerisation and microservices support

How Google Kubernetes Engine (GKE) greatly simplifies e-commerce application management

Google Kubernetes Engine (GKE) on GCP significantly simplifies the management of e-commerce applications through support for containerisation and microservices. GKE automates the deployment, scaling and management of containers, enabling applications to be launched quickly and efficiently. With GKE, microservices can be managed with ease to maintain high availability and application flexibility, both of which are vital for keeping up with the fast-changing demands of e-commerce.

Cost efficiency and pricing model in Google Cloud Platform

Optimising operational costs with GCP's flexible pricing model

Google Cloud Platform (GCP) offers a flexible pricing model, making it straightforward to keep operational costs under control. With its pay-as-you-go model, payment is only required for resources actually used, avoiding unnecessary expenditure on idle infrastructure. GCP also supports automatic scaling of resources to reflect current e-commerce needs. Additionally, GCP’s advanced analytics tools assist in monitoring and optimising resource usage, generating further savings.

Process automation in Google Cloud Platform

How GCP automation streamlines e-commerce infrastructure management

Google Cloud Platform (GCP) provides advanced process automation tools that simplify e-commerce infrastructure management. Services such as Cloud Deployment Manager and automated scripts allow resources to be configured and deployed quickly, without the need for manual intervention. GCP automation supports effective management of updates, scaling and monitoring, reducing the risk of human error and boosting operational efficiency. The result is a more efficient e-commerce platform, leading to better customer experience and time savings.

How much does e-commerce hosting on GCP cost?

The cost of e-commerce hosting on Google Cloud Platform (GCP) depends on many factors, such as resource consumption, data storage requirements, bandwidth, and additional services. GCP operates on a pay-as-you-go model, so payment is only required for resources actually used.

For instance, monthly costs may include:

  • Compute instances (VMs): from a few to several hundred USD, depending on computing power and region.
  • Data storage: costs vary according to the volume of data stored and the type of storage selected (e.g. SSD or HDD)
  • Bandwidth: charges for data transfer between GCP services and to the internet.
    GCP also comes equipped with a cost calculator to help estimate monthly expenses based on the specific needs of your e-commerce business. With a flexible payment model, costs can be managed effectively by scaling resources in response to changing business needs.

Does GCP provide adequate security for e-commerce data?

Yes, Google Cloud Platform introduces advanced protection for e-commerce data in line with top industry standards. With GCP, you get:

  1. Data encryption: all data stored in GCP is automatically encrypted both in transit and at rest, protecting it from unauthorised access.
  2. Advanced authorisation and authentication mechanisms: GCP employs mechanisms such as OAuth 2.0 to govern access to resources and guarantee that only authorised users can retrieve data.
  3. Monitoring and logging: GCP delivers real-time monitoring and logging tools to assist in detecting and responding to suspicious activity.
  4. Regulatory compliance: GCP meets international compliance standards such as GDPR, HIPAA and PCI-DSS, ensuring that e-commerce data is stored and processed in accordance with applicable regulations.

With these advanced security measures, Google Cloud Platform provides a reliable and secure environment for your e-commerce operations.

What backup and disaster recovery options does GCP offer for e-commerce?

Google Cloud Platform (GCP) includes advanced backup and disaster recovery options to support business continuity.

  1. Automatic snapshots: with GCP, virtual machines are regularly snapshotted, so the system can be restored quickly in the event of a failure.
  2. Google Cloud Storage: data can be held in Google Cloud Storage, which boasts high availability and durability. You can configure automatic data backups across multiple geographic regions, protecting against data loss in the event of a local failure.
  3. Google Cloud SQL and BigQuery: regular database backups. If a failure occurs, data can be rapidly restored from backups, reducing downtime.
  4. Google Cloud Datastore: supports automatic data versioning, allowing previous versions to be recovered when needed.
  5. Disaster Recovery Plan (DRP): GCP provides tools and services for building comprehensive DRPs, including automatic failover and data replication between regions, ensuring high availability and rapid service restoration.

These backup and disaster recovery options protect e-commerce data and support its swift recovery in the event of a failure, minimising downtime and maintaining business continuity.

How does Google Cloud Platform differ from other cloud services in the context of e-commerce?

Google Cloud Platform (GCP) stands out from other cloud providers in several key ways that are critical for e-commerce:

  1. Advanced analytics tools: GCP includes Google BigQuery, a powerful tool for analysing large data sets in real time, allowing e-commerce companies to quickly process and analyse data, which is essential for making informed business decisions.
  2. Integration with AI and ML: Google Cloud AI and TensorFlow are well integrated with GCP, enabling the use of advanced art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ms to personalise shopping experiences and optimise e-commerce operations.
  3. Global infrastructure network: GCP’s extensive global network ensures low latency, high performance, and quick access to services and data for customers everywhere.
  4. Security: GCP employs advanced security measures, such as encrypting data both at rest and in transit, along with identity and access management tools, guaranteeing strong data protection.
  5. Cost flexibility: GCP’s pay-as-you-go model allows you to optimise costs by paying only for the resources you actually use. GCP also offers a variety of pricing options and discounts for long-term commitments.
  6. Containerisation support: with Google Kubernetes Engine (GKE), GCP leads in containerisation and microservices management, simplifying the scaling and administration of e-commerce applications.

These qualities make GCP a compelling choice for e-commerce businesses seeking scalable, secure and forward-thinking cloud solutions.
